Impact PPV likely canceled, podcast guest, free EVOLVE match, WWE Netflix movie update, new Dynamite match, 24/7 title switch, interesting wrestling venue, and Questions on COVID-19 precautions, WWE filming, and who should and shouldn't be in MITB

Impact Rebellion is listed as canceled due to the coronavirus. Maybe they'll move the advertised matches from Lockdown, WrestleCon, and Rebellion to TV tapings on the road to Slammiversary.

Sean Waltman is on Booker T.'s latest podcast.

EVOLVE has uploaded Austin Theory vs. Darby Allin from EVOLVE 121.

Netflix's "The Main Event" does not have John Cena or Bray Wyatt, though earlier drafts included them in the script.

Dynamite has added Cody vs. Jimmy Havoc.

R-Truth won the 24/7 Championship from Riddick Moss. Pretty fun.

A UK promotion ran a show inside a cave. I guess that's one way to stay quarantined.
